
Huawei Enjoy 10 Plus: A Closer Look at Specs and Cameras
Huawei announced the launch of the Enjoy 10 Plus smartphone in 2019. The manufacturer is offering the Huawei Enjoy 10 Plus phone with 6.59 inch display, HiSilicon Kirin 710F chipset, 4 GB of RAM and 128 GB of internal storage.
The Huawei Enjoy 10 Plus series was launched with Android OS v9.0 (Pie) pre-installed, but it is upgradable to newer versions of OS as they become available. System
OS version | Android OS v9.0 (Pie) |
---|---|
SoC | HiSilicon Kirin 710F |
CPU | Octa-core, Quad-core 2.2 GHz Cortex-A53, Quad-core 1.7 GHz Cortex-A53 |
GPU | Mali-G51 MP4 |
The Huawei Enjoy 10 Plus comes with Android OS v9.0 (Pie) out of the box, but it is upgradable to the next OS. Android is closely integrated with various Google services, such as Google Maps, Gmail, and Google Drive, which makes it easy for users to access and manage their data across multiple devices. The Enjoy 10 Plus utilizes HiSilicon Kirin 710F chipset. This octa-core CPU is managed by an advanced scheduler that allocates tasks to the CPU for speed and power efficiency in real time.
The Enjoy 10 Plus utilizes Mali-G51 MP4 GPU. A GPU (Graphics Processing Unit) is a specialized chip that is primarily designed to handle and accelerate the processing of graphics and visual data. It is responsible for rendering images, videos, and animations on a smartphone screen. ARM Mali GPUs are widely used in mobile devices and have a good reputation for performance and power efficiency. They offer competitive performance and power efficiency, making them suitable for a range of applications, including gaming, multimedia, and user interface rendering.

Camera
Main camera | 48 + 8 + 2 MP, 8000 x 6000 px, autofocus |
---|---|
Flash | LED |
Selfie camera | 16 MP |
This smartphone features a multi-camera setup. Multiple cameras or depth sensors can enhance the smartphone's ability to create appealing portrait mode effects, including background blur or bokeh. This can be useful for creating multi-camera shots, 3D effects, or immersive content. The main camera of the Enjoy 10 Plus is equipped with autofocus. An autofocus (or AF) optical system uses a sensor, a control system and a motor to focus on an automatically or manually selected point or area. Very few Android cameras come without autofocus. The Enjoy 10 Plus does not have optical image stabilization (OIS). OIS technology is more commonly found in higher-end smartphones and is designed to reduce camera shake and blur, resulting in sharper and clearer images and videos.
Connectivity
GSM 2G bands | 850 / 900 / 1800 / 1900 |
---|---|
Network coverage | 2G / 3G / 4G |
Wi-Fi | Wi-Fi 802.11 b/g/n |
Bluetooth | v4.2, A2DP |
GPS | A-GPS, GLONASS |
NFC | no |
FM radio | yes |
USB | USB Type-C |
Headphone | 3.5 mm jack |
The Huawei Enjoy 10 Plus supports 4G/LTE networks. 4G stands for fourth-generation mobile networks, which are wireless networks that provide faster data transfer speeds and greater network capacity than previous 3G networks. The Huawei Enjoy 10 Plus supports the latest Wi-Fi standards. Wi-Fi is now a ubiquitous technology that is widely used in homes, businesses, public spaces, and other environments around the world.
With Bluetooth connectivity, you can connect your Enjoy 10 Plus smartphone to a wide range of Bluetooth-enabled devices, such as headphones, speakers, smartwatches, fitness trackers, and more. The Enjoy 10 Plus has a GPS receiver. GPS allows smartphones to determine their precise location and provide accurate navigation and mapping services. This includes turn-by-turn directions, real-time traffic updates, points of interest, and alternative routes.
The Enjoy 10 Plus isn't NFC (Near Field Communication) capable. NFC is not essential for basic phone functionality, but it can be useful for a variety of tasks and features. The Enjoy 10 Plus phone has built-in FM radio receiver. FM radio allows users to tune in to local radio stations and listen to live broadcasts, news, music, and other content. The Enjoy 10 Plus has an USB Type-C port. Type-C is a small, reversible connector that can be plugged in to a device in either orientation, making it more convenient to use than older USB connectors that only worked when plugged in a certain way. The Enjoy 10 Plus smartphone has a 3.5 mm headphone jack. A 3.5 mm headphone jack is a small round port, that allows you to connect wired headphones or earphones to the device.
Battery
Type | Li-Po 4000 mAh, non-removable |
---|
The Li-Po 4000 mAh, non-removable battery gives the smartphone a good battery backup. The lithium polymer (Li-Po) battery is a thin, light-weight, rechargeable battery. No periodic discharge is needed and charging can be done at random. The battery of Enjoy 10 Plus isn't removable without voiding the warranty.
Features
Sensors | accelerometer, compass, fingerprint, gyroscope, light, proximity |
---|---|
Specials | Dual SIM, GPU Turbo |
Smartphones today come with a wealth of sensors to facilitate a better user experience. The accelerometer provides information about the smartphone's movement in three axes: X (horizontal), Y (vertical), and Z (depth). The Enjoy 10 Plus phone has a fingerprint scanner. This sensor identifies and authenticates the fingerprints of an individual in order to grant or deny access to a smartphone. This Huawei phones come with proximity sensor. This proximity sensor detects how close the phone is to an outside object, such as your ear.
The Enjoy 10 Plus phone comes with a compass sensor. A compass sensor is a device that provides accurate directions in relation to the earth's North and South magnetic poles. The ambient light sensor detects the level of ambient light in the surrounding environment. The main purpose of a light sensor in a smartphone is to automatically adjust the brightness of the device's display. The Dual SIM capability of Huawei Enjoy 10 Plus phone is ideal for businesses wishing to provide staff with a mobile device that can offer separate numbers and bills for both personal and business use.
